PRG Reviewer's Choice Award finalist for Best Urban Fantasy series.

Ivy Granger thought she left the worst of Mab's creations behind when she escaped Faerie. She thought wrong.

In a cruel twist of fate, Ivy has unleashed a powerful horde of Unseelie beasts upon her city, turning her homecoming into a potential slaughter of innocents. Now Ivy must gather her allies to fight a reputedly unstoppable force - The Wild Hunt.

Will the training Ivy received in her father's court be enough to save her city, or will Harborsmouth be forced to kneel before the Lord of the Hunt? She is willing to risk her own life, but some sacrifices come at a cost worse than death. When an ally is bitten by one of The Wild Hunt's hounds, Ivy must face the possibility that winning this battle may mean killing the one person she has come to love most.

Hound's Bite is the fifth full-length novel in the award-winning, best-selling Ivy Granger urban fantasy series by E.J. Stevens. The world of Ivy Granger, including the Ivy Granger Psychic Detective series and Hunters' Guild series, is filled with action, mystery, magic, dark humor, quirky characters, bloodsucking vampires, flirtatious demons, sarcastic gargoyles, sexy shifters, temperamental witches, psychotic faeries, and snarky, kick-butt heroines.

The Ivy Granger series has won numerous awards, including the BTS Red Carpet Award for Best Novel, the PRG Reviewer's Choice Award for Best Paranormal Fantasy Novel, Best Urban Fantasy Novel, and finalist for Best Urban Fantasy Series.

By now you know I'm a sucker for the extras in audio. The first thing we hear are the howls that Ivy hears as she speaks, questioning what the howls are. This has me liking the audio from the first moment. We get a female and male voice team for this book. All feminine voices are performed by Melanie and all male by Anthony. It adds a nice flavor and contrast to the characters as we listen. I like the sound that they give to Herne's voice.

The refresher was shorter in this book, thankfully. Though when we meet someone we get their back story as of now. I'm one for working this into the story not just giving it to me at seeing the person in the beginning of the book. But that's my preference, not everyone's.

At times I found sentences that were more poetic than others. There are also sentences that made the story feel as though it was for a young adult crowd (which it's really not) because it told what was implied the sentence before, instead of letting the impression for the reader be all that was needed. I like how the writing has improved as well. Ivy doesn't just point something out about herself, the events and others guide to that moment of a bigger feeling.

Ivy has grown into a strong woman. She has to do the things that are hard, and stop someone that's dangerous. She's written more in what she's doing than just telling us how she is. Ivy also has to face consequences of what's been done in the past.

This book feels to be deeper in the plot. There is more reason to the Wild Hunt being here than originally thought. And I like the connections to the reasons. They feel on the larger scale than the previous books. There is more to come and more going on outside of Ivy's little world than we knew.

Jinx has her own drive in this book. She's working to free the streets of the dangerous drug Ice. It was something that was used on her and killed another, but that story can be found in Club Nexus. This is a wonderful tie in and building of the character that we've seen through the stories.

I very much enjoyed this story. It felt to tie a bunch of strings from the previous books together here. Everything leads up to something. What the characters have lived through and why the events have happened. I like this connection as the story feels to have a great depth to it.

Hound’s Bite is an exciting supernatural adventure with cool characters, lots of action, and a bit of romance. This is part of a series, but works just fine as a standalone. If you are looking for a detective novel though, this particular book probably isn’t what you’re after.

Suitable for teens and adults. May be too violent or scary for younger readers.

The narrators have a fun time with the book and include sound effects in with the narration to make things a bit more exciting.

Fun narration! There’s sound effects and voice modulation going on. The female narrator did a good job too. There’s also some male narration; a little stiff at times, but still good.

Entertaining magical adventure for Ivy and all her friends! For the best reading experience, I recommend reading the previous books, but this book does have its own complete adventure. In this one, the Wild Hunt is after Ivy, and someone has kidnapped someone Ivy considers family. Lots of danger going on! The story does move a bit slow at times; lots of planning and lots of characters to deal with, but I still enjoy the read. Love all the Fae aspects, and I enjoy the light, fun vibe to the story. I’d like a bit more depth of emotion, more romance; what is there is really sweet though, and some more action, but overall, this series has been great!
